Project AMBER

National Skill Development Corporation (NSDC) and Generation India ANS - A


Foundation (GIF) have launched the Project AMBER (Accelerated
Mission for Better Employment and Retention) in New Delhi.
• Purpose - to bridge the gap between skilling and employment by
empowering India’s youth with industry-relevant skills.
• Funding - Ministry of Skill Development and Entrepreneurship
(MSDE) under the Skills Acquisition and Knowledge Awareness for
Livelihood Promotion (SANKALP) programme.
o The BlackRock Foundation and McKinsey & Company are
supporting the project.
Project AMBER

• Target - to train 30,000 youth, of which 50% shall be women. ANS - A

• Training centres - Pradhan Mantri Kaushal Kendras (PMKKs) across 70


districts
• Skill Sectors - COVID-resilient job sectors like general duty assistant,
junior full stack developer, retail sales associate, customer service
executive, sewing machine operator, hospital front desk executive, solar
PV installer, food & beverage steward

India’s Aditya L1 Mission:
• Proposed Date – Q3 2022
• At the same time, India will launch its second space observatory Xposat,
aimed at helping astronomers’ study cosmic sources such as pulsars and
supernova.
• The spacecraft in the Aditya L1 mission will be sent 1.5 million km away from
the Earth to L1 Lagrangian.
o L1 Lagrangian is a point between the Earth and the Sun.
o Here, the gravitational pull of both the Earth and the Sun on the satellite is
equal to the force needed to keep the satellite in orbit.
o It is like a parking area in space and is great for observing several
phenomena without hindrances from eclipses.
• The Gaganyaan mission is also likely to be undertaken by the
end of 2022 or in early 2023.

Xposat Observatory
• It will be launched aboard a small satellite launch vehicle (SSLV),
which is in the developmental stages.
• It will help scientists in studying the supernova and pulsar stars.
